Course overview

Diploma of Community Services (CRICOS course code 118766G) is a Diploma delivered by INT Nurse Training Pty Ltd over 2 years. This qualification, with VET national code CHC52025, is at AQF Level 5 and falls under the field of Human Welfare Studies and Services. It prepares students to work in community services, focusing on case management, client advocacy, and program coordination. The course includes a mandatory work component of 10 weeks (40 hours per week) to provide real-world experience. As a CRICOS-registered course, it is available to international students under the Student visa (Subclass 500).

Duration and study mode

The course runs for 2 years (104 weeks) as per the CRICOS register. Instruction is in English. It is a single qualification (not a dual award) and does not include foundation studies. The study mode is likely full-time on-campus, but students should confirm with INT Nurse Training. The duration includes the work placement component. International students must maintain full-time enrolment to comply with visa conditions.

Fees (indicative — set by INT Nurse Training Pty Ltd)

Indicative tuition fee is A$16,500 for the entire course, with non-tuition fees of A$800, totalling an estimated A$17,300. These fees are sourced from the CRICOS register and are subject to change. Additional costs include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C), living expenses, and the visa application charge. Living costs vary by location: in Dubbo, weekly rent is around A$250–350; in St Marys (Sydney), expect A$300–450. Always check the provider's website for current fees. Student visa

International students need a Student visa (Subclass 500) to study this course. The visa allows work rights: 48 hours per fortnight during term and unlimited during scheduled breaks (subject to visa conditions). You must maintain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C) for the entire stay. The Genuine Temporary Entrant (GTE) requirement assesses your intention to stay temporarily.
